Louis Pasteur, a prominent French scientist, played a crucial role in advancing the understanding of fermentation and the role of microorganisms in this process. His confirmation of Theodor Schwann's fermentation experiments provided significant evidence that yeast, previously thought to be simple organisms, were indeed microorganisms responsible for fermentation. This finding was pivotal in shifting the scientific community's perspective on fermentation, which had been largely influenced by the miasma theory that attributed infections to foul odors rather than to specific biological agents. Pasteur's work laid the groundwork for the germ theory of disease, which fundamentally changed the approach to microbiology and medicine.
The implications of Pasteur's research extended beyond fermentation; it also had a profound impact on various industries, including brewing, winemaking, and food preservation. By understanding the role of yeast and other microorganisms, Pasteur was able to develop methods to control fermentation processes, leading to improved quality and safety in food production. His discoveries not only enhanced the efficiency of these industries but also contributed to public health by reducing the incidence of spoilage and contamination. Overall, Pasteur's confirmation of fermentation experiments marked a significant advancement in microbiology, influencing both scientific thought and practical applications in food and health.
